Output 2babb1282a5b59d67bcd051a4369176612425c9f90fad7fb53cb1b88ea7e1ecb:1

value
18780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b707fb718c1ac3d0141aaebc92332d900976395 OP_EQUAL
address
A59ZMcZT73P353ob2jeuxmkzUCHsw7vwHK
transaction
2babb1282a5b59d67bcd051a4369176612425c9f90fad7fb53cb1b88ea7e1ecb